We are seeking a talented and experienced Civil Design Manager. The qualified candidate will oversee a wide variety of greenfield and add/move/change projects for colocation and hyper-scale data centers from due diligence, campus planning, conceptual/schematic/detailed design through construction documents, and construction administration. The ideal candidate has experience managing the design of industrial and data center civil and utility infrastructure, has a background in civil engineering, and possesses exceptional written and verbal communication skills. Key Responsibilities • Lead data center due diligence, planning, and design teams to deliver projects that meet the client's requirements, on schedule and to a high degree of quality. Design disciplines will include prototype development, test fitting, mass grading, stormwater management, utility prepositioning and design (power, telecommunications, and water/ wastewater pumping, storage, and conveyance), and on- and off-site roadways. • Develop and enforce multi-site project and program management plans. • Host and attend meetings with clients and external stakeholders. • Proactively manage and communicate change throughout the project both within AECOM and to our clients. • Early identification and mitigation of project risks with creative solutions. • Proactively communicate with all stakeholders to provide project updates and resolve outstanding issues. • Develop technical and financial proposals for new and add/move/change data center design projects • Develop trusting relationships with client and sub/partner consultant stakeholders • Coach junior staff and support professional growth. • Foster a culture of accountability, innovation, and strategic thinking. About AECOM

AECOM is a global provider of professional technical and management support services to a broad range of markets, including transportation, facilities, environmental, energy, water and government. With approximately 45,000 employees around the world, AECOM is a leader in all of the key markets that it serves. AECOM provides a blend of global reach, local knowledge, innovation and technical excellence in delivering solutions that create, enhance and sustain the world's built, natural, and social environments. A Fortune 500 company, AECOM serves clients in more than 150 countries and had revenue of $8.0 billion during the 12 months ended March 31, 2014.
